How make a career in EdTech Customer Experience Operations Manager

A career as an EdTech Customer Experience Operations Manager offers a unique opportunity to enhance the educational experience through technology. This role involves overseeing customer service operations, ensuring that users have a seamless experience with educational technology products. To pursue this career path, individuals typically need a strong academic background in education, business administration, or a related field. A bachelor's degree is essential, and many professionals enhance their qualifications with a master's degree in education technology or business management. Gaining practical experience through internships, customer service roles, or project management in the education sector is crucial. Networking with professionals in the EdTech field and staying updated with the latest technologies and trends in education are also vital. With a blend of education, experience, and a passion for improving educational outcomes, one can build a rewarding career dedicated to enhancing customer experiences in the EdTech industry.

What are the roles and responsibilities in EdTech Customer Experience Operations Manager?

  • Managing Customer Support : Oversee customer support teams to ensure timely and effective responses to user inquiries and issues.
  • Analyzing Customer Feedback : Collect and analyze feedback from customers to identify areas for improvement in products and services.
  • Developing Training Programs : Design and implement training programs for users to maximize the effectiveness of educational technology tools.
  • Collaborating with Product Teams : Work closely with product development teams to relay customer insights and influence product enhancements.
  • Monitoring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) : Track and report on KPIs related to customer satisfaction, retention, and operational efficiency.

What are the key skills required for EdTech Customer Experience Operations Manager

  • Communication Skills - Effective communication is vital for interacting with customers and stakeholders and for conveying complex information clearly.
  • Analytical Skills - These skills are crucial for interpreting customer feedback and data to inform operational strategies.
  • Problem-Solving Skills - The ability to identify issues in customer experiences and develop innovative solutions is essential for success.
  • Project Management Skills - Managing projects efficiently, including timelines and resources, is key to successful outcomes in customer experience operations.
  • Technical Skills - Proficiency with customer relationship management (CRM) software and educational technologies is important for effective operations.

What is the salary and demand for EdTech Customer Experience Operations Manager?

  • Salary Overview - The typical salary for EdTech Customer Experience Operations Managers ranges from $60,000 for entry-level positions to over $120,000 for experienced professionals, with variations based on education and location.
  • Regional Salary Variations - Salaries can vary significantly by region; for example, EdTech professionals in urban tech hubs may earn more than those in rural areas.
  • Current Job Market Demand - The demand for EdTech Customer Experience Operations Managers is growing due to the increasing reliance on technology in education and the need for improved customer support.
  • Future Demand Projections - Future demand for these professionals is expected to rise as educational institutions increasingly adopt new technologies and prioritize customer satisfaction.

Pros & Cons of a Career in EdTech Customer Experience Operations Manager

Pros

  • EdTech Customer Experience Operations Managers play a crucial role in enhancing the educational experience, making their work impactful and fulfilling.
  • The field offers competitive salaries, especially for those with advanced degrees and specialized skills.
  • Professionals in this field contribute positively to the integration of technology in education, improving learning outcomes for students.
  • The career provides opportunities for continuous learning and advancement in a rapidly evolving industry.

Cons

  • The job can be demanding with long hours, especially during peak product launches or customer service surges.
  • Some roles may require extensive collaboration with remote teams, which can be challenging.
  • The fast-paced nature of the EdTech industry can lead to job instability or high turnover rates.
  • The work can sometimes be isolating, particularly when focusing on data analysis and operational tasks.
